Cast polypropylene films find a wide range of applications across various industries due to their exceptional properties. In the packaging sector, these films are extensively used for food packaging, pharmaceutical packaging, and industrial packaging. Their high clarity, excellent sealability, and moisture barrier properties make them ideal for preserving the quality and extending the shelf life of packaged products. Additionally, cast polypropylene films are popular in the labeling and lamination market for their printability, durability, and resistance to tearing and puncturing, ensuring that labels and laminates maintain their integrity and appeal.
Moreover, the automotive market utilizes cast polypropylene films for interior and exterior trim components, offering benefits such as cost effectiveness, lightweight construction, and resistance to chemicals and heat. The agriculture sector also leverages these films for crop packaging, greenhouse covers, and mulching applications, benefiting from their UV resistance, water resistance, and ability to withstand extreme weather conditions. Overall, the versatility and adaptability of cast polypropylene films make them indispensable in a wide array of applications, contributing significantly to different sectors with their reliable performance and quality.

One of the primary challenges encountered by the cast polypropylene films market is the intensifying competition from other flexible packaging materials. With the continuous advancements in technology and innovation, alternative materials such as polyethylene terephthalate (PET) and polyvinyl chloride (PVC) have become more appealing to consumers and manufacturers. This growing competition poses a threat to the market share of cast polypropylene films, thereby necessitating the market players to focus on differentiation and value added offerings to maintain their competitive edge.
Another significant challenge faced by the cast polypropylene films sector is the fluctuating prices of raw materials. The market heavily relies on propylene, a byproduct of the oil refining process, for the production of films. Any volatility in the prices of crude oil and other raw materials directly impacts the manufacturing costs of cast polypropylene films, leading to margin pressures for companies. Managing these cost fluctuations while ensuring quality and profitability remains a persistent challenge for market players striving for sustainability and growth.
